[Asia Economy Reporter Changhwan Lee] Samsung Fire & Marine Insurance announced on the 1st that it held an online seminar on the 29th of last month for clients and insurance industry officials to help them respond to regulations related to the Fair Trade Act and the Serious Accident Punishment Act.


The Samsung Fire & Marine Insurance 'Corporate Safety Forum' was conducted in two sessions.


The first session featured a presentation by Attorney Seungho Choi of the law firm Kwangjang, focusing on the importance of compliance with the Fair Trade Act through case law and examples.


The second session was led by Attorney Sangmin Kim of the law firm Taepyungyang, who explained trends in the Serious Accident Punishment Act and directions for corporate response.


The Corporate Safety Research Institute, which organized the forum, has continuously diagnosed risk levels and proposed improvement measures through specialized consulting in fields such as fire, electricity, human safety, logistics, and industrial safety, aiming to prevent accidents for corporate clients.



Lee Munhwa, Vice President of the General Insurance Division at Samsung Fire & Marine Insurance, stated, "We prepared this forum to address curiosity about the importance of compliance with the Fair Trade Act, trends in the Serious Accident Punishment Act, and directions for corporate response," adding, "We will continue to faithfully fulfill our role as a risk management partner that leads safety culture and supports corporate safety management."
